Understanding the Importance of Omega-3

Wiki Article

These dietary fats are essential for optimal health. Omega-3s are known for their health-boosting properties, including enhancing heart and brain health, and reducing inflammation.

Omega-3 can usually be found in certain foods. Fatty fish like salmon, mackerel, and sardines, chia seeds, walnuts, and flaxseeds are great providers of these essential fatty acids.

Sometimes, diet alone can't provide the necessary amount of these fatty acids. In this situation, omega-3 supplements can make up for the deficiency.

These dietary additions are a practical solution and provide the required nutrient without having to consume large amounts of certain food.

It is, however, crucial to pick the correct supplement. Not all omega-3 products give the same results.

The most effective omega-3 supplements should be rich in docosahexaenoic acid (DHA) and eicosapentaenoic acid (EPA). These two forms of omega-3s are the most beneficial for health. Most notably, they promote heart and brain health, contrarily to other forms of omega-3, such as alpha-linolenic acid (ALA), which the body has a harder time using.
